Plot to assassinate Putin is direct path to nuclear war — State Duma speaker

A plot to assassinate Russian President Vladimir Putin and discussions on the subject constitute a crime and a serious threat to global security, said Vyacheslav Volodin, the speaker of the State Duma (the Russian parliament’s lower chamber).

“The plot to assassinate Putin, mere discussions of it is a crime, a serious threat to global security, a direct path to nuclear war. All international institutions should view it as a basis for an investigation,” Volodin wrote on Telegram.

He believes that amid the current tough confrontation, the Russian society needs to “understand the level of challenges and threats that we are facing, and, therefore, understand their own responsibility.”

According to Tucker Carlson, the Joe Biden administration considered assassinating Putin. The US journalist said that, in general, the US authorities intended to engage in a suicidal confrontation with Moscow. In particular, former US Secretary of State Antony Blinken was “pushing so hard for a real war” between the US and Russia in his last two months in office.

China will work with Russia as a great power:President Xi

The President of China has said that he is willing to work alongside Moscow to increase stability in the world.

Chinese President Xi Jinping told his Russian counterpart that Beijing wants to work with Moscow to take the responsibility of great powers at the Shanghai Cooperation Organization summit in Samarkand.

President XI also said that China is willing to make efforts with Russia to play a guiding role to inject stability and positive energy into a world rocked by social turmoil.

likewise, President Putin praised the “multifaceted ties” the two countries have forged.

President Putin affirmed Moscow’s support for Beijing’s ‘One China’ policy and condemned “the attempts at provocations by the United States in and around Taiwan.

President Putin thanked China for its cooperation on the foreign policy stage and said,”We highly value the balanced approach of our Chinese friends when it comes to the Ukrainian crisis.”

Telephone conversation between French President Macron and Russian President Putin leaked


Telephone conversation between French President Emmanuel Macron and Russian President Putin has been leaked.

Russian Foreign Minister Sergey Lavrov has called the leaking of a telephone conversation between French President Emmanuel Macron and Russian President Vladimir Putin a “violation of diplomatic etiquette.”

Stating that such recorded talks should not have been unilaterally made public in the context of diplomatic dignity, Lavrov said there was nothing to embarrass Russia about the content of the talks between the two leaders.

Secret phone conversation between President Putin and President Macron, a day before the Military operation in Ukraine was revealed by broadcaster France 2 in a documentary on the French president’s handling of the conflict.

President Putin request to help Afghanistan

Russian President Vladimir Putin has called on the United States to help save Afghanistan’s economy. He says the United States has been involved in Afghanistan for two decades and should provide assistance.

“Those who have been there for 20 years and have destroyed the economy must first provide assistance,” Putin said in response to a question from reporters at the annual press conference.

He also said that the assets of Afghanistan, which have been blocked by the United States and other countries, should be released. Putin also called on the Taliban to form an inclusive government representing all ethnic groups.
